Has an AFL game ever ended 115-105?
Exactly once. On May 18, 1974, Richmond beat Essendon 115-105, and no AFL game before or since has ended that way. When it happened it was a scorigami, the first 115-105 in league history.
That makes 115-105 the 3836th most common final score out of 6,607 that have ever occurred in AFL. One point away, 116-105 has happened never and 115-106 has happened never.
